Title: Cheolhee Won: Innovator in Bioactive Substance Delivery Systems
Introduction
Cheolhee Won is a prominent inventor based in Seoul, South Korea. He has made significant contributions to the field of pharmaceutical compositions and bioactive substance delivery systems. With a total of 8 patents to his name, his work focuses on innovative solutions for medical applications.
Latest Patents
One of his latest patents is a physiologically active substance carrier. This bioactive substance delivery system includes a bioactive substance comprising nucleic acid and a carrier made of porous silica particles. These particles have a diameter ranging from 5 nm to 100 nm and can maintain a specific absorbance ratio for at least 24 hours. Notably, the porous silica particles may be positively charged inside the pore at neutral pH.
Another significant patent addresses a pharmaceutical composition for preventing or treating liver cancer. This invention provides siRNA or dsRNA that effectively inhibits the expression of three highly expressed markers in liver cancer. The pharmaceutical composition can achieve excellent effects in preventing or treating liver cancer through RNA interference.
